Indicators of Oral Emergency Situations



Recognizing the signs of dental emergency situations is critical for timely activity and proper treatment. If you experience serious tooth pain that's constant and throbbing, it could show an underlying concern that needs prompt interest.

Swelling in the periodontals, face, or jaw can also suggest a dental emergency situation, specifically if it's accompanied by discomfort or fever. Any kind of kind of injury to the mouth causing a broken, broken, or knocked-out tooth should be dealt with as an emergency situation to prevent additional damage and potential infection.

Bleeding from the mouth that does not stop after applying stress for a couple of mins is another red flag that you need to look for emergency oral care. Additionally, if you observe any type of indications of infection such as pus, a foul taste in your mouth, or a fever, it's necessary to see a dentist as soon as possible.

Overlooking these signs might cause much more serious problems, so it's crucial to act promptly when faced with a prospective oral emergency.
